About This Food

JosiDog Master Mix is a complete dry food for adult dogs, providing a balanced diet with moderate protein and fat levels. It supports healthy digestion with beet fiber and chicory, and includes green-lipped mussel for joint health. This formula is suitable for all dog breeds.

This dry food is intended for dogs of all ages.

Notable ingredients: prebiotic or probiotic ingredients support a healthy gut microbiome; natural antioxidants (Vitamin E, rosemary, or Vitamin C) help protect cells.

On paper, the numbers read: 22% protein — moderate protein content for a dry food, 11% fat, 3% fiber.

Ingredients

Composition Whole grain corn, barley, dried poultry protein, meat and bone meal, beet fiber, poultry fat, rice, hydrolyzed poultry protein, hydrolyzed animal protein, corn protein, minerals, ground chicory root (natural source of inulin), beetroot powder (0.10%), dried New Zealand green-lipped mussel protein (Perna canaliculus).
